STUDENT TEAM ACHIEVEMENT DIVISIONS (STAD) AND ACHIEVEMENT IN READING COMPREHENSION OF LOW ACHIEVING STUDENTS IN MAKURDI METROPOLIS, BENUE STATE

The paper sought to investigate the effect of the Student Team Achievement Divisions (STAD) strategy of cooperative learning on achievement in reading comprehension of low achieving students in selected secondary schools in Makurdi Metropolis. A total of 21 low achieving students in selected Junior Secondary Schools constituted the sample of the study. One research question and one hypothesis guided the study. The quasi- experimental design was adopted using intact classes. The Reading Comprehension Achievement Test (RCAT) was used to generate data. It was trial tested and found to be reliable. Data generated were analyzed using mean scores to answer the research question and Analysis of Co-variance (ANCOVA) to test the hypothesis at 0.05 level of significance. The finding showed that low achieving students taught using STAD performed significantly better than those taught using the non-cooperative method of instruction. A major recommendation was also proposed: sensitize teachers, students and school proprietors to regular and correct use of cooperative learning.
